Python.

Python language was developed by Guido van Rossum in 1989 while working at ‘Centrum Wiskunde & Informatica (CWI) at Netherland.

Guido van Rossum from Netherland is still alive and working with Microsoft. In 80s the programming language name “ABC Programming” was available and he found mistakes in it and modified the new programming language name “Python”.

 

How the name Python was kept?

Python name was kept after inspired from an old comedy TV show named “Monty Python’s Flying Circus” which was broadcasted in BBC from 1969 to 1974 approx., which was liked by him. Hence he decided and kept name Python as he liked a short and unique name.

 

How he started his research for python?

Generally Guido van Rossum was on Christmas leave that movement but he don’t won’t to spend his leaves empty and wont to do some work on leaves also. Hence he utilized his leaves and started some research in “CWI Lab” “Centrum Wiskunde & Informatica” at Netherlands.
He was motivated by ABC Programming Language. He started his research on “APC Programming” and corrected some mistakes and started to develop a new programming language on his leaves.
Finally, in 1991, officially Python was made available to public on dated 20th Feb 1991.
The Predecessor of Python programming language is ABC Programming Language.
